1847 discovery: Chlorine handwashing cut childbirth deaths 90%, doctors ignored it

Mon, 07/06/2026 - 19:09
In a radical move, Ignaz Semmelweis mandated handwashing in hospitals, drastically reducing maternal mortality rates. Despite evidence supporting his approach, he faced fierce opposition from fellow medical professionals, as he couldn't provide a scientific rationale for his findings. Much later, the establishment of germ theory validated his revolutionary work, leading to fundamental changes in medical practices that ultimately saved innumerable lives.

Non-stop rain cuts off Mumbai as rail, highway traffic hit; schools, colleges shut today

Mon, 07/06/2026 - 18:16
Mumbai experienced severe disruptions due to heavy rains and strong winds for the third consecutive day. Torrential showers also affected other regions, with Palghar district being the worst hit. Schools and colleges were declared closed in Mumbai, Thane, Palghar, and Raigad due to the ongoing weather warnings. Transport services faced significant disruptions, including train cancellations and highway closures due to landslides and waterlogging.

148 newborn die in 3 months in Assam's Barak Valley; infra gaps under scanner

Mon, 07/06/2026 - 18:13
Barak Valley recorded 148 newborn deaths over three months. Cachar district reported the highest fatalities, followed by Sribhumi and Hailakandi. Deaths were mainly due to birth asphyxia and low birth weight. Rural healthcare infrastructure and delayed referrals worsened the situation. Investment in rural maternal and child healthcare is urgently needed.

The Allahabad High Court has directed the central government and ASI to file responses. This follows a petition challenging an Agra court's refusal to allow a Taj Mahal survey. Petitioners claim the monument is an ancient Hindu temple called Tejo Mahalaya. They seek permission to perform prayers and conduct a survey. The court is asked to set aside lower court orders and decide the application.

Microsoft layoffs: Company cuts 4,800 jobs; to reduce 2.1% global workforce

Mon, 07/06/2026 - 13:52
Microsoft has laid off 4,800 employees, about 2.1% of its global workforce, as its new fiscal year begins, with Xbox and commercial sales taking the biggest hits. HR chief Amy Coleman told employees the business is changing because the industry around it is changing, insisting AI isn't replacing these roles. Xbox alone loses 1,600 jobs now, with 3,200 more planned this year as CEO Asha Sharma resets the gaming division.

Saudi Arabia slashes August oil prices for Asia by $11 in biggest cut in over 20 years

Mon, 07/06/2026 - 13:44
Saudi Arabia has slashed its crude oil prices for Asian customers by a significant $11 per barrel for August, the largest reduction in over two decades. This move reflects weakening demand in Asia and easing geopolitical tensions, which have stabilized global oil markets. With supply conditions improving and Middle Eastern shipping routes normalizing, Saudi Aramco is adjusting its strategy to maintain market share amidst increased competition.
